Transaction 17f5232742ae69b13fb25577de3d4c2fceb170fdf314440ee8143e362bb714e3

1 Input
2 Outputs
  • 17f5232742ae69b13fb25577de3d4c2fceb170fdf314440ee8143e362bb714e3:0
  • value  261440
    address  15ViYH5MSBCtCNQ3YiMGvtWdQbwpyvTgB9
  • 17f5232742ae69b13fb25577de3d4c2fceb170fdf314440ee8143e362bb714e3:1
  • value  906941674
    address  bc1qerfuph7lqqumr34aucwy4u4srnv32ed3rcn7jy